Moroccan state paid $ 945 million in subsidies
Morocco, Economics, 9/15/2000
The Moroccan state has paid a total of 10.4 billion DH ($ 945 million) in subsidies to oil and basic products, which represents 60% of the state annual investment budget and more than the budget deficit.
Head of the compensation board, Najib Benamour, told the 2nd TV channel "2M" between 4.3 to 4.4 billion DH (between $ 390 Mln and $ 400 mln )went to subsidizing energy products while the rest was used to subsidize wheat, food products and sugar.
He also hoped that oil prices on international markets would decrease following the announcement by Venezuelan oil minister, who is also OPEC chairman, that the organization will increase its production to stabilize prices between $ 22 and $ 25.
On September 1st, the government announced increases in fuel prices in Morocco.
The official statement announcing the fuel price increases explained that the government has delayed several times the decision and the state had to sustain between August 1999 and August 2000 a burden of 2.57 billion DH ($ 233 million) to avoid reflecting the international oil prices on consumers.
